A driver's permit (also known as a learner's permit, learner's license, or provisional license) is a restricted license that first-time drivers must obtain before they are allowed to get a full driver's license. The driver's permit allows you to drive a motor vehicle (with certain restrictions) before you have passed your driving test. The age ...

Tennessee Permit Test Facts. Questions: 30. Correct answers to pass: 24. Passing score: 80%. Test locations: Department of Safety (DOS) Offices. Test languages: English, Spanish, Hindi, Vietnamese. Yes, with a permit, you can drive to school, but only under the supervision of a licensed adult driver or legal guardian. Can you take your permit test online? No, the permit test in must be taken in person at an authorized Driver Services Center. Can you get a permit at 14? No, the minimum age to apply for a learner’s permit in Tennessee is 15.After you pass your permit test. Tennessee Driving Permit Rules and Restrictions. After getting a Tennessee learning license, novice drivers will be able to improve their driving skills by operating cars within restricted situations. The permit test is comprised of written questions about Tennessee state-specific traffic laws, road signs, and rules of safe driving. The test questions have been created from material found in the Tennessee Driver’s Manual and cover a range of topics including vehicle safety responsibility, right-of-way, signals, signs, and markers, parking, stopping, and standing, alcohol and drug impact ... All questions are up-to-date and based on 2024 Tennessee Driver's Manual.What is on the Permit Test in Tennessee? The main areas covered by the exam questions are traffic signs and signals (25%), safe driving techniques (25%), rules of the road and Tennessee laws (25%), and drugs and alcohol (25%). For your service, select Any Knowledge Test Appointment.In order to apply for your permit, the State of Tennessee requires that you provide the following documents: Proof of identity. Social Security card. Proof of residence. Proof of citizenship or legal presence. Proof of enrollment in a public or private school.
